AltmanZ scores are well regarded measure as to an outfits balance of assets liabilities and ability to service liabilities. A score close to zero suggests a company is heading toward bankruptcy. VOD’s is -0.51.
The board actions suggest stresses not being honestly relayed to the market. Why did they buy back that bond last week then borrow more money at higher interest? Bond holders preassuring them to get them out of the bond?
Whilst they could manage their borrowings in the low rate world, this new world is pilling on the pressure of managing the debt.

The Debt markets LOVE Vodafone ....and are quite happy to roll over any debts as they come due ..... what lender doesn't want to lend ??..they wouldn't be in business if they stopped lending ....and as they pretty much know VOD can pay the yearly coupons and any debt interest payments they are all fine ....especially when they know they have assets behind the debts
VOD themselves just needs to be focused on which territorial businesses give them a satisfactory ROCE and which are struggling in the face of huge competition....
countries like Egypt and Turkey have huge population numbers and could recover in 2024 as Emerging economies improve after the flight to the Dollar of 2022 ..so selling wouldn't give them the best price unless they negotiated hard for future earnings potential within the sell price

Gary, you list liabilities as if it's all financial debt, while ignoring the fact Vodafone Revenue is on target for over €45 Billion in the current Financial Year, with H1 revenue coming in at €22.930 Billion. Liabilities include operating expenses which are covered by revenue. If you're going to paint a picture, don't show it in the dark.
